[QUOTE="10gary22, post: 1007316, member: 23626"]If you are handy and like to keep your gold close, I like floor safes cemented in. Of course whatever option you choose for storing the coins themselves can be put in Ziplock storage bags then secreted in the safe. For the common circulated mint sets. I use the Dansco Books with the slides. Then you can show both sides of each coin for conversation. Better coins are slabbed and in storage boxes, stored in bank vaults. Mostly, I use magnifiers and am still looking for an optimum combo. I have a magnifying lamp 7x that I use in tandem with a triplet loupe 10x,20x,30x. Thin cotton gloves. Small bent needlenose pliers. Stapler. Large tupperware lids for sort trays. etc Tools are all about what and how you collect. I believe everyone has different ideas and tools that work best for them. Many error searchers today have USB microscopes along with cameras, light booths, etc. I would start with a basic loupe and work my way up from there. gary[/QUOTE]
